Understanding Plato's Closet and its Hiring Needs
Before diving into the application, understand what Plato's Closet looks for in its employees. They typically value individuals who are:
- Passionate about fashion: A genuine interest in clothing trends and styles is crucial.
- Customer-focused: Excellent interpersonal skills and a friendly demeanor are essential for interacting with customers.
- Organized and detail-oriented: Managing inventory and maintaining a clean store requires meticulousness.
- Team players: Plato's Closet is a collaborative environment; teamwork is vital.
- Reliable and responsible: Punctuality and a strong work ethic are highly valued.
Finding the Plato's Closet Employment Application
The first step is locating the application itself. While some retailers use third-party job boards exclusively, Plato's Closet often utilizes their own website for applications. Begin by:
- Visiting the Plato's Closet website: Go to the official Plato's Closet website. The exact URL may vary slightly depending on your region.
- Locating the "Careers" or "Jobs" section: This section is usually found in the footer or a prominent navigation menu.
- Searching for open positions: Use the search function to filter by location and job type (e.g., sales associate, store manager).
- Selecting your preferred store: Once you've found a suitable position, select the specific Plato's Closet location where you wish to apply.
Completing the Plato's Closet Application Form
The application form itself will likely ask for standard information, but accuracy is key. Ensure you:
- Provide accurate contact information: This includes your phone number, email address, and current address.
- Complete your work history thoroughly: Include dates of employment, job titles, and brief descriptions of your responsibilities for each previous role. Highlight relevant experience, such as customer service, retail, or sales.
- Craft a compelling resume: While some applications are built into the form itself, many will also ask for a resume. This is your opportunity to showcase your skills and experience in a more detailed and structured way. Tailor your resume to highlight skills relevant to the position.
- Answer application questions thoughtfully: Some applications may include behavioral questions. Take your time to formulate thoughtful responses demonstrating your suitability for the role. Consider using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ers.
- Proofread carefully: Errors in your application can create a negative impression. Take your time to proofread your responses for grammar, spelling, and punctuation errors.
Following Up After Submitting Your Application
After submitting your application, consider these steps:
- Send a thank-you note: A brief thank-you email reinforces your interest and professionalism.
- Follow up (appropriately): After a week or two, it's acceptable to follow up with the hiring manager to inquire about the status of your application.
Tips for a Successful Plato's Closet Job Application
- Dress the part: If you have an interview, dress professionally and appropriately for the retail environment.
- Research the company: Show your enthusiasm by demonstrating knowledge of Plato's Closet's business model and target market.
- Highlight transferable skills: Even if you lack direct retail experience, emphasize transferable skills such as communication, teamwork, and problem-solving.
- Be enthusiastic and positive: Your attitude can significantly impact the interviewer's perception of you.
